About the role

  • This role leads client engagements from planning through execution while supporting day-to-day HR operations and high-impact init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• Lead client projects from scope through delivery, managing timelines, stakeholders, and outcomes.
  • Advise leadership on strategic initiatives, including organizational design, succession planning, and workforce planning.
  • Develop and maintain strong client relationships through responsive, high-quality service.
  • Design and analyze compensation strategies, including market-based pay structures and recommendations.
  • Execute recruiting and performance management processes, including hiring support and performance reviews.
  • Facilitate training programs and workshops (virtual and in person) and support employee engagement initiatives.
  • Research HR policies, update handbooks, and support safety and compliance initiatives.
  • Manage priorities, track progress, and maintain accurate reporting for client work.
  • You'll partner directly with client leaders to deliver both strategic and hands-on HR support.
